Operation Definition

Taking or letting out fluids and/or gases from a body part

Procedure Overview

This family covers procedures that remove fluid or gas from an area of the arm, forearm, wrist, hand, or elbow when the collection is not confined to a single tissue layer that has its own specific body system in ICD-10-PCS - for instance, a diffuse hematoma, abscess, or seroma spanning skin, subcutaneous tissue, and muscle after trauma or surgery. Surgeons open, aspirate, or place a drain in the region to relieve pressure, prevent infection, or obtain fluid for laboratory analysis. It is commonly performed after a crush injury, a failed compartment closure, or a post-operative wound complication in the upper limb.

Because the drainage targets the region broadly rather than a named organ or structure, the operative note usually describes the anatomic zone (upper arm, forearm, hand) instead of a discrete muscle or vessel.

Anatomy & Axis Detail

Shoulder Region, Left

On the left side, the shoulder region - covering the deltoid muscle mass and the bursal and soft-tissue planes surrounding the glenohumeral joint - is a common site for postsurgical hematoma, infected bursa, or abscess tracking from adjacent structures. Drainage procedures here address fluid outside the joint capsule itself, ranging from simple percutaneous aspiration to open incision and placement of a drain for a more extensive or recurrent collection. The region's dense muscular coverage and overlying neurovascular bundle mean the surgeon must select an approach that avoids the axillary nerve and posterior circumflex vessels while still reaching the collection effectively. Correct coding depends on confirming that the target is regional soft tissue rather than the joint itself, along with left-side laterality and whether a drainage device remains in place afterward.

Approach: Percutaneous Endoscopic

Percutaneous Endoscopic combines a puncture through skin or mucous membrane with insertion of an endoscope to visualize the procedure internally, as in laparoscopic cholecystectomy. It is distinguished from plain Percutaneous by the presence of scope-guided visualization, and from Via Natural or Artificial Opening Endoscopic by its route being a new puncture rather than an existing orifice or stoma.

Device: Drainage Device

Drainage Device denotes a device such as a tube or catheter left in place to remove fluid, blood, or air from a body part or cavity following a procedure. It is distinguished from Monitoring Device, which senses and records physiologic data rather than evacuating substances from the body.

Coding & Documentation

A coder should turn to this family only after confirming the operative report does not identify a specific body part with its own ICD-10-PCS value - if the surgeon drains a defined muscle compartment or a named tendon sheath, the more specific body system takes priority. Documentation needs to state the approach (open, percutaneous, or via natural/artificial opening) and whether a drainage device was left in place, since that changes the qualifier. The most frequent error is defaulting to the anatomical-regions body system out of convenience when the note actually supports a more specific site, which understates the precision of the code.

Commonly Confused With

This is easily confused with Excision when a small amount of infected tissue is removed along with the fluid; if tissue is taken for debridement rather than just fluid being let out, Excision or Extirpation may be the correct root operation instead. It also overlaps with Drainage coded to a specific muscle or subcutaneous tissue body system - the distinguishing factor is always whether the documentation ties the fluid collection to one named structure or describes it as diffuse across the regional anatomy.
